When you fly into clouds you become fogged in until you fly out - varies on density of cloud.
Hard to fly when in those circumstances... but reailistic

I used to have this in P2 then i realised it was because i had zoomed myself back in my cockpit to get a better view of it.
What you have there is the side effect of the zooming, it only shows up in cloud and has something to do with the zoom changing the resolution or picture size of the cloud texture...or something like that.
